1. A wireless communication method performed by a user equipment (UE), comprising:
receiving first downlink control information (DCI) used for a first coverage enhancement (CE) level, the first DCI including frequency domain information and time domain information, the frequency domain information indicating a number of physical resource blocks (PRBs) from a plurality of candidates for the number of PRBs in a frequency domain within a narrowband which is a part of a bandwidth, and the time domain information indicating a number of repetitions in a time domain; and
controlling a reception of a physical downlink shared channel (PDSCH) by using the number of physical resource blocks (PRBs) and the number of repetitions in the time domain,
wherein a number of bits of the first DCI is smaller than that of second DCI used for a second CE level, the second CE level being lower than the first CE level.
